Throughout the years we have learned that wet or humid weather can impede the knuckleballer from getting a good grip on the baseball. After he releases the baseball, there are numerous theories on how atmospheric conditions affect the flight and movement of this flutter ball. There have been opinions on pitching in Domes versus outdoors, cold weather vs warm weather, and wind blowing in vs. wind blowing out. It is why I really don't like having to depend on them.
